• 欢迎使用千万蜘蛛池,网站外链优化,蜘蛛池引蜘蛛快速提高网站收录,收藏快捷键 CTRL + D

如何进行PHP MySQL数据库的日常维护?掌握这些日常操作,避免出现意外情况


数据库是现代网站和应用程序的重要组成部分,对于PHP开发人员而言,熟练掌握MySQL数据库的日常维护和操作是必不可少的。

一、数据库备份

数据库备份是保障数据安全的重要手段,常见的备份方法有两种:

1、使用命令行工具进行备份:

mysqldump -u username -p database_name > backup_file.sql

2、使用php脚本进行备份:

<?php
$username = '用户名';
$password = '密码';
$database = '数据库名';
$backup_file = '备份文件名.sql';

$command = "mysqldump -u {$username} -p{$password} {$database} > {$backup_file}";
system($command, $return_value);
?>

数据库恢复

数据库出现问题时,通过恢复备份可以快速恢复数据,常见的恢复方法有两种:

1、使用命令行工具进行恢复:

mysql -u username -p database_name < backup_file.sql

2、使用PHP脚本进行恢复:

<?php
$username = '用户名';
$password = '密码';
$database = '数据库名';
$backup_file = '备份文件名.sql';

$command = "mysql -u {$username} -p{$password} {$database} < {$backup_file}";
system($command, $return_value);
?>

数据库优化

为了提高数据库的性能,我们可以采取以下措施进行优化:

1、优化表结构,删除不必要的字段,添加索引等。

2、定期更新数据表的统计信息,以便MySQL能够更有效地查询数据。

3、调整MySQL的配置参数,如缓冲区大小、连接数等。

4、使用慢查询日志分析查询性能,优化SQL语句。

php mysql数据库的日常维护_日常操作

5、使用分区表、分库分表等策略,提高查询性能。

数据库监控与维护

为了保证数据库的正常运行,我们可以采取以下措施进行监控与维护:

1、使用SHOW STATUS命令查看MySQL服务器的状态信息。

2、使用SHOW PROCESSLIST命令查看当前正在运行的进程。

3、使用EXPLAIN命令分析SQL语句的执行计划。

4、定期检查磁盘空间,确保有足够的空间存储数据。

5、定期检查MySQL的错误日志,解决发现的问题。

php mysql数据库的日常维护_日常操作

通过以上措施,我们可以确保PHP MySQL数据库的日常维护和操作的稳定性和高效性能。

感谢您的阅读,请在下方评论留言,关注我们的社交媒体,点赞和分享该文章,谢谢!

本文链接:https://www.24zzc.com/news/171852365485340.html

蜘蛛工具

  • WEB标准颜色卡
  • 域名筛选工具
  • 中文转拼音工具